RECORDEDOctober 20 Tuesday10:30 AM → 11:30 AMSessions: 1Instructor: Dr. Brian Belanger, Curator, National Capital Radio & Television MuseumLocations: Oasis at Macys Home StoreRadio news prior to WWII was minimal. But then CBS hired Edward R. Murrow, who in turn hired journalists such as Eric Sevareid, Charles Collingwood, and Larry LeSueur. The CBS evening news roundup took listeners via shortwave radio from city to city, bringing the war viscerally into American living rooms. Planning DirectorLocations: Oasis at Macys Home StoreCharles Goodman, architect, brought modern housing to Montgomery County. Called "the most elegant" builder of the local post-World War Two housing boom, his signature “walls of glass” of asymmetrical window grids and fireplace as sculpture reflect the optimism and openness of Mid-Century Modernism.
